    Two of us stayed at the Essex in June, 2005 for 4 nights. The lobby is very small, but clean. The desk personnel are friendly. Luggage help when arriving may be slow or non-existant. Some customers had a misunderstanding about the cost of telephone calls. Be sure you understand the rules before using. My room was supposed to be smoke free, but it had been used by smokers with burn marks on furniture. The draperies were in very poor condition...dirty, worn rips and stains. Carpet was warn and stained. Bed spreads were old. Room was well cleaned though with courteous room help. The bath needs refurbished badly. There was a hole in the tile from previous fixtures. The hotel is at the end of the strip, but close to the parks. The hotel restaurant is good for breakfast and lunch with good service and reasonable city prices. There are not nicer restaurants near this hotel, except for high price hotel restaurants like at the Congress or Hilton. Price of room was in the $125 plus taxes.
